Given below are two statements : 

Statement I : Upon heating a borax bead dipped in cupric sulphate in a luminous flame, the colour of the bead becomes green. 

Statement II : The green colour observed is due to the formation of copper(I) metaborate. 

In the light of the above statements, choose the most appropriate answer from the options given below : 

(1) Both Statement I and Statement II are true 

(2) Statement I is true but Statement II is false 

(3) Both Statement I and Statement II are false 

(4) Statement I is false but Statement II is true

(3) Both Statement I and Statement II are false 

(Borax Bead Test) 

On treatment with metal salt, boric anhydride forms metaborate of the metal which gives different colours in oxidising and reducing flame. For example, in the case of copper sulphate, following reactions occur.

Two reactions may take place in reducing flame (Luminous flame)

(i) The blue-green Cu(BO2)2 is reduced to colourless cuprous metaborate as :

(ii) Cupric metaborate may be reduced to metallic copper and bead appears red opaque.
